Which pulleys for P/S setup?
1971 F100 Custom 2wd 360FE
I added the Saginaw box, and Power steering pump & bracket using the helpful guide. I guess when I scavenged the parts from the bone-yard I didn't notice that the pulleys were different also.
When I eyeball the pump pulley with the fan - it looks as though I'll need a three groove pulley to match it. Is that right? I don't have A/C. Does the belt run from the harmonic balancer up to the pump? Or does it also run through the fan pulley?

i went out to get the numbers but there was too much in the cab. but i looked under my hood the alt goes there to crank and pump pulley the power steering goes from the crank to pump to ps. the ac is on the outside pulley and catches the crank the idler and the a/c. so you would /should only need a two groove for the bottom pulley and two groove for the pump pulley. since you don't have a/c

ok my crank pulley has the large gear torward the rad. i have the pump pulley from a car which is smaller than the one that came on the truck engine. my belts are all gates they are 7410 7525 and 9600. the old belts wer e smaller because of the larger pump pulley. my engine is a 390. with ps and air. if that doesnt help then maybe go to the parts store and see if you can get a stock belt and try it for fit if it doesnt work then a person could trade it back in for a new size.
